WebDec 14, 2024 · As CEO and founder of Carl’s Sandwiches, you earned a $60,000 salary in 2024, and the company also earned a net profit of $200,000 that year, which you’re entitled to 50% of—or $100,000. Because Carl’s Sandwiches is an S corp, you’ll only have to pay self-employment tax on the $60,000 salary, and not on the $100,000 distribution.
